Motorist without helmet dies in south Delhi mishap

New Delhi: In a tragic accident, a young professional guitarist died in a road accident after his Harley Davidson collided with a scooty on the Chirag Delhi BRT corridor in the intervening night of Thursday and Friday at around 1:30 am.
Pravesh Kumar, 24, was a professional guitarist and had done various stage shows. Several of his videos are uploaded on Youtube as well as other ocial media platforms.
On the fateful night, Pravesh was coming towards Chirag Delhi BRT corridor along with his friend Amit where the Harley Davidson collided with a speeding scooty that was coming from Pushpa Vihar side. The impact of the collision was such that all five people, two on Harley Davidson and three on the scooty were thrown several meters and sustained grievous injuries.
"We immediately rushed the injured to the hospital where Pravesh who had suffered major injuries collapsed and was declared brought dead by the doctors," said a senior Police officer in South East Delhi.
The police also said that neither Pravesh nor any other accident victims were wearing helmets.
The impact also lead to grievous and serious injuries to Amit who was on the Harley Davidson with Pravesh. His condition is said to be critical and has still not gained consciousness.
"One boy on the scooty is also unconscious and the other two have sustained fractures in their legs and hands. They have been admitted to the hospital where there condition is being monitored," said an officer.
Pravesh resided in Madangir of south east Delhi, a Delhi University student with a passion for guitar since he was a young boy. He has also uploaded several videos composing various tunes on Facebook.
On January 10 he enthusiastically urged his friends to see his music video that he did with Bollywood playback singer Kamal Khan.
